Embark on a private tour to explore the breathtaking Danube Bend, one of the most beloved tourist destinations just a short distance from Budapest. Marvel at the natural beauty and rich history of this picturesque region as you visit Visegrad High Castle, soak in the charm of the baroque town of Szentendre, and take a glimpse into the enchanting neighborhood of Obuda in Budapest.
Your journey begins with a scenic ride to Visegrad, located 40 km north of Budapest. Along the way, you’ll have the chance to take a glimpse into Obuda (Old Buda), a captivating neighborhood in Budapest known for its ancient ruins of Aquincum, a Roman capital, Romai beach, a vibrant summer scene with its simple and affordable restaurants, cafes, and bars, as well as the renowned Sziget Festival, one of the largest music events in Europe. Next, brace yourself for an exhilarating ride on the winding roads of Duna-Ipoly National Park before arriving at Visegrad, the heart of the Danube Bend.
At Visegrad High Castle, you’ll be treated to a mesmerizing view of the Danube Bend, and learn about local history. As you take in the stunning scenery, you’ll also savor a delicious lunch at a panoramic restaurant, indulging in the flavors of the region.
In the afternoon, you’ll explore Szentendre, a quaint baroque town known for its Mediterranean atmosphere, complete with cobblestone streets, narrow alleys, colorful houses, churches, museums, and art galleries. You’ll have time to stroll around the charming main square lined with cozy cafes, restaurants, and souvenir shops, and even try a local favorite meal, “langos” – pan-fried dough with sour cream and cheese.
On your way back to Budapest, you’ll enjoy a scenic ride along the Danube riverbanks, taking in breathtaking views of the iconic Parliament Building and other famous landmarks of the city.
